Table Rate Shipping

Calculate shipping based on weight, price, quantity, dimensions, or any combination. Build unlimited rules per zone with priority ordering and fallback options.

Conditional Rules

Show or hide shipping methods based on cart contents, customer location, user role, coupon usage, or product categories. Chain multiple conditions with AND/OR logic.

Real-Time Carrier Rates

Connect to USPS, UPS, FedEx, DHL, and Canada Post for live rate quotes at checkout. Cache rates to avoid API slowdowns and show estimated delivery dates.

Distance-Based Shipping

Charge customers based on driving or straight-line distance from your warehouse using Google Maps API. Perfect for local delivery businesses and same-day courier services.

Per-Item Shipping

Set a base rate plus an additional charge per item or per unique product. Ideal for dropshipping stores with multiple suppliers shipping separately.

Free Shipping Rules

Offer free shipping based on cart total, specific products, categories, or customer membership level. Configure minimum order thresholds and display progress bars at checkout.

Shipping Classes

Group products by handling requirements. Add extra fees for fragile, oversized, hazardous, or refrigerated items. Override classes at product or variation level.

Hazmat & Surcharges

Configure special surcharges for dangerous goods, hazardous materials, and oversized freight. Automatically apply regulatory fees and restrictions to qualifying products.

Shipping Insurance

Offer optional or automatic shipping insurance at checkout. Calculate premiums as a percentage of cart value. Integrate with InsureShield and other insurance providers.

Estimated Delivery Dates

Display realistic delivery date ranges at checkout based on carrier transit times, your processing schedule, and local holidays. Increase checkout confidence.

Rate Comparison Widget

Show customers a side-by-side comparison of available shipping methods with prices, delivery times, and carrier logos. Help customers make informed decisions.

Import / Export

Export shipping tables to CSV for backup or bulk editing. Import complex rate tables in seconds. Migrate entire shipping configurations between staging and production sites.

Easy Installation

Get up and running in minutes

1

Purchase & Download

Complete your purchase and download the plugin ZIP file from your dashboard.

2

Upload to WordPress

Go to Plugins > Add New > Upload Plugin in your WordPress admin and select the ZIP file.

3

Activate Plugin

Click "Activate" after installation completes.

4

Enter License Key

Go to the plugin settings and enter your license key to activate updates and support.
